Take Action for the Planet with the Youth Climate Action Initiative

Are you a young person (16-29) in the GTA who wants to learn about sustainability and climate action while developing the skills needed to become an agent of sustainable change in your community? Join the Youth Climate Action Initiative by Skills for Change!

Benefit from:

  • Building connections with like-minded peers;
  • Nature-based activities such as urban gardening, tree planting, and forest therapy walks;
  • Free environmental education, tours, events, and workshops in the community;
  • Free weekly sustainability and leadership-focused learning sessions;
  • Opportunity to develop your own Community Climate Action Project.
Apply now to be a part of the solution!
  • Hybrid format (virtual with optional in-person activities)
  • 10-week duration; 2-4 hours per week commitment
  • Sustainability Leader Certificate following the completion of the program
  • Volunteer experience (and volunteer hours upon request)
  • Focus on Jane and Finch, Weston, Thorncliffe Park, Flemingdon Park, and Black Creek areas
